What Is the Difference Between Interior and Exterior Paint?

What Is the Difference Between Interior and Exterior Paint?

Rodrigo Pereira Teixeira |

Choosing the right type of paint is essential for achieving long lasting results. Many homeowners assume paint is universal, but interior and exterior paints are specifically engineered for very different environments. Using the wrong type can lead to premature failure, peeling, fading, or surface damage.

What Is Interior Paint Designed For?

Interior paint is formulated for controlled indoor environments. It is designed to:

  • Resist scuffs and stains

  • Be easy to clean

  • Provide a smooth, attractive finish

  • Have low odor and low VOC options

  • Dry faster in stable temperatures

Interior paint does not need to withstand rain, snow, or extreme temperature swings. Instead, it focuses on durability against everyday wear and tear such as cleaning, touching, and furniture contact.

What Is Exterior Paint Designed For?

Exterior paint is engineered to handle harsh outdoor conditions, especially in climates like Ottawa where weather can be extreme.

Exterior paint is made to:

  • Withstand freeze and thaw cycles

  • Resist UV fading

  • Protect against moisture penetration

  • Prevent mold and mildew growth

  • Expand and contract with temperature changes

The flexibility built into exterior paint allows it to move with siding materials without cracking.

Can You Use Exterior Paint Indoors?

It is not recommended. Exterior paint contains additives designed for weather resistance, which may result in stronger fumes and longer curing times indoors. Interior paints are specifically formulated for indoor air quality and occupant safety.


Can You Use Interior Paint Outdoors?

No. Interior paint lacks the durability and weather resistance needed for exterior surfaces. If applied outside, it will likely peel, crack, and fade quickly due to sun exposure and moisture.


What About Finish Differences?

Both interior and exterior paints come in various finishes such as:

  • Matte

  • Eggshell
  • Satin

  • Semi gloss

  • Gloss

Interior finishes are selected based on traffic level and cleanability. Exterior finishes are chosen for durability and protection against the elements.

Why Is Proper Paint Selection So Important in Ottawa?

Ottawa’s climate includes:

  • Cold winters with heavy snowfall

  • Hot summers with strong UV exposure

  • High humidity during seasonal transitions

Using the correct exterior paint protects your home from moisture damage and structural deterioration. Using the proper interior paint ensures durability and air quality inside your home.


How Do Professionals Choose the Right Paint?

Experienced painters consider:

  • Surface material

  • Exposure to sunlight

  • Moisture levels

  • Desired finish

  • Traffic and usage

  • Colour retention

Selecting the right product from the beginning prevents costly repainting and repairs later.
